McKay's cricket journey has been full of stops, but he is still on his way

Bushranger Clint McKay appeals during a Sheffield Shield match last season. The Melbourne boy, who has been called up to the Australian one-day team, has styled his game on Australian Test great Glenn McGrath. Full Article at The Age
